18:05 — Occupancy feed for the Larchgate garages went stale. The sensor aggregator in Veldspan kept publishing the 17:52 snapshot, so the app showed full garages as empty. Detected at 18:19 via the staleness alarm. Cause: a stuck file lock after log rotation on the aggregator host. Mitigation: service restart at 18:24, feed current by 18:26. Follow-up: add a watchdog that force-releases locks older than two minutes. The aggregator version in service during the incident is recorded by the token below.

pipeline stamp: htk4_c337

**ChipGate Reader — Environments**

ChipGate ingests timing-chip pings at the Harlowe Marathon finish line. Three environments: dev (simulated chips), staging (replayed race data), prod (live). Promote dev → staging → prod only; no hotfixes direct to prod on race weekends. Staging mirrors prod hardware as of the Verdane build. Current prod configuration values are listed below.

deployment values, bafop-fadup:
[belath]
team = oliius
access_code = ac_015d0e
host = belath.orvexcloud.example
port = 11211
owner = ulaael.ralael
peer = gorir.qirvanforge.corp

## Project Saltmere — Acquisition Overview (Managers Only)

Welcome aboard. Short version: we're in early talks to acquire Fenwick & Dray, a small tooling shop whose Copperline product overlaps nicely with our roadmap. Diligence kicks off next month, and only people on this page know. Marta will walk you through the numbers, but first read the note below.

internal memo for baduf-fafop: Normirix Works is in early talks to buy Ulaoxox Partners for about $497.5 million. The Wenael launch date is October 14, and nothing goes to the press before then. Legal wants the Nordorax Logistics term sheet countersigned before September 22.